Foot-Pound per Minute (Mechanical Power)
Introduction : The foot-pound force per minute quantifies work done at a steady rate in mechanical systems. It equals the amount of energy (in ft·lbf) delivered each minute, often used in torque-based devices.
History & Origin : Used extensively in pre-SI British and American mechanics, this unit helped engineers and machinists determine tool output, torque efficiency, and motor workloads before the widespread adoption of watts.
Current Use : Still seen in the US for small-scale mechanical outputs and in technical documentation for engines, hand tools, and rotating machines. Also relevant in legacy systems using imperial torque metrics.
Femtowatt (10⁻¹⁵ Watt)
Introduction : The femtowatt represents one quadrillionth (10⁻¹⁵) of a watt. It is a unit of extremely small power, typically relevant only in highly specialized scientific research where energy levels are at the molecular or quantum scale.
History & Origin : Developed as part of the SI system’s scaling for extremely small measurements, the femtowatt emerged with advancements in nanotechnology, photonics, and particle physics, where detecting and quantifying minuscule power became essential.
Current Use : Used in quantum optics, single-photon measurements, and in advanced biomedical sensors. It plays a role in disciplines requiring ultra-precise energy measurements such as astrophysics and high-sensitivity detectors.
